Clemson Post Game Notes From The 1999 Chick-fil-A Peach Bowl

Dec. 30, 1999

Clemson Offensive MVP of the Game Brian Wofford caught six passes for 147 yards…the reception yard total is a Clemson record in a bowl game…the senior from Spartanburg, SC finished his career with the fourth most reception yardage in Clemson history with 1,857 yards on 138 catches.

Clemson Defensive MVP of the Game Sophomore Chad Carson finished the Peach Bowl with a game high 11 tackles…Carson had two tackles for loss that included one sack for a six yard Mississippi State loss…he also broke up three passes.

Adams Breaks Clemson Single Season Tackle Record Sophomore linebacker Keith Adams broke Anthony Simmons’ Clemson single season tackle record at the Peach Bowl…Adams needed three tackles to break Simmon’s record of 178 and he had seven to finish the season with 183…Simmons is now a linebacker for the Seattle Seahawks…Adams had three tackles for loss in the contest to go along with a recovered fumble and a pass broken up.

Streeter Breaks Clemson Bowl Game Passing Records Brandon Streeter finished the Peach Bowl completing 24-of-50 pass attempts for 301 yards…all three figures are Clemson bowl game records…the graduate student also scored Clemson’s only touchdown of the game.

Mississippi Native Fox Has Nine Tackles Clemson’s only Mississippi native, DoMarco Fox, had nine tackles in the Peach Bowl, the second highest total among all players in the game.
